Cage Cashier (Part Time)
Rivers CasinoPittsburgh, United Statesfull_timeVerifiedPosted 13 Feb 2026
About the role
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Provides a high level of guest service while adhering to established department and property policies and procedures while working in the Cage.
- Responsible for learning and performing a wide variety of monetary transactions for our guests, such as check cashing, chip redemption, lottery and voucher redemption as well as understanding the casino and compliance systems.
- Assists in the safeguarding of company assets by ensuring all distinguishing job duties are performed according to established company policies and procedures.
- May assist with building cassettes and balancing the bill validators for the ticket redemption and lottery machines. May at times respond to a guest dispute at a lottery machine.
- Handles guest questions, complaints or problems in a prompt and courteous manner. When unclear, passes information to a Supervisor for assistance.
- Enrolling/reprinting of Rush Rewards Club cards, explanation of benefits and promotions.
- Maintain and safeguard the confidentiality of guest/player information; Discuss confidential customer information only with appropriate department and division heads.
- Maintain working knowledge of casino, including but not limited to hours of operation of casino, restaurants, and other amenities and responds to guest questions regarding the same.
- Distribute, redeems and verifies promotional items in accordance with specific promotion guidelines with enthusiasm.
- Verifies the guests phone number, email address, or if all information is accurate and updates the information when necessary.
- Verify valid/acceptable photo ID in accordance with Rivers Casino/PGCB standards with every transaction.
- Informs supervisor when additional coin or currency is needed during shift.
- Communicates pertinent information to supervisors such as guest service issues, payout discrepancies, variances and any other abnormality that may occur during their work day.
- Responsible for sports wagering ticket redemption.
- Clean and maintain office and public areas to ensure a safe environment.
- Work as a team with other casino departments in a respectful manner.
- Performs other duties as requested or assigned.
Qualifications: (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ities):
- Must possess outstanding interpersonal communication skills (verbal and written) to effectively interface with guests and Team Members.
- Must be able to work flexible shifts and days of the week including holidays.
- Must have the ability to remain professional and tolerate stress related to servicing public guests in a high pressure and fast-paced environment on the Casino Gaming floor.
- Must be able to be constantly exposed to casino-related environmental factors, including, but not limited to second hand smoke and excessive noise.
- The job functions encompass a varied combination of physical functions, including, but not limited to the following:
- Constant standing, walking, reaching outward, occasional reaching about the shoulder level and frequent squatting, kneeling, and bending
- Finger/hand dexterity to maneuver on computer keyboard, office machinery and other tools.
- Ability to lift or carry up to 25 pounds.
- Ability to push/pull up to 25 pounds.
- Must be able to traverse through the Casino to arrive at assigned locations.
- Must be able to learn and retain knowledge of computer systems, procedures and regulatory requirements.
- Must be able to frequently bend at the waist, bend at the knees, reach, push/pull up to 10lbs., twist at the waist and shoulders and have finger/hand dexterity to maneuver on computer keyboard and other tools.
- Must be able to constantly and accurately communicate effectively and politely in spoken English, with Team Members and guests to answer questions, provide information and check for guest satisfaction.
- Must demonstrate the 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ide without the use of a calculator, use a point of sale system, handle cash and other financial transactions quickly and accurately.
- Must be able to use a point of sale system, handle cash and other financial transactions quickly and accurately.
- Must be able to successfully fulfill the pre-employment process.
- Must obtain and maintain all necessary licensing.
